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
557778 4290831710 34077141 25541
8568605701 958519
8568605701 958519
19 676 4227 3126730991
All about undefined
Interested in learning more?
8568605701 958519
19 676 4227 3126730991
See more
64 2049835
76 51 480005 8117670 6945238
See more
430779 09007
65 5342778263 59 78
See more